Exploring decision-making through a neurological lens, this book contrasts traditional decision science with cutting-edge neural modeling. It introduces advanced computer models that accurately predict economic choices driven by intuition rather than deliberation. The author envisions a novel social science framework where neural models of emotion and cognition elucidate the complexities of socioeconomic systems and social networks. Written for both experts and advanced students, the text is grounded in the author's extensive background in decision science and computational neuroscience.
